Skip to content

Bump electron from 5.0.4 to 7.0.1#338

Closed
dependabot-preview[bot] wants to merge 1 commit into
masterfrom
dependabot/npm_and_yarn/electron-7.0.1
Closed

Bump electron from 5.0.4 to 7.0.1#338
dependabot-preview[bot] wants to merge 1 commit into
masterfrom
dependabot/npm_and_yarn/electron-7.0.1

Conversation

@dependabot-preview
Copy link
Copy Markdown
Contributor

Bumps electron from 5.0.4 to 7.0.1.

Release notes

Sourced from electron's releases.

electron v7.0.1

Release Notes for v7.0.1

Fixes

  • Fixed shell.openExternal() option workingDirectory not working with Unicode characters. #20905
  • Fixed a crash in Menus related to menu.popup(). #20808
  • Fixed a label mismatch on open and save dialogs on GTK. #20882
  • Fixed a regression in the recentDocuments role on macOS. #20670
  • Fixed an issue where objects referenced by remote could sometimes not be correctly freed. #20693
  • Fixed crashes when calling webContents.printToPDF() multiple times. #20810
  • Fixed devtools extensions not loading due to "Connect to unknown extension [object Object]" errors. #20844
  • Fixed flicker when switching between BrowserViews. #20846
  • Fixed fs.mkdir/mkdirSync hang with {recursive: true} for invalid names with node 12 on windows. #20629
  • Fixed hang when closing a scriptable popup window using the remote module. #20715
  • Fixed memory leaks caused by callbacks not being released when the remote module is used in sub-frames (<iframe> or scriptable popup). #20814
  • Fixed native module size increase on windows, follow up fix to https://github-redirect.dependabot.com/electron/electron/pull/20614. #20708
  • Fixed several deprecation warnings in Electron code. #20804

Other Changes

  • Updated Chromium to 78.0.3904.92. #20913

Documentation

  • Documentation changes: #20757

electron v7.0.0

Release Notes for v7.0.0

Notable Changes

  • Stack upgrades:
Stack Version in Electron 6 Version in Electron 7 What's New
Chromium 76.0.3809.146 78.0.3905.1 77, 78
V8 7.6 7.8 7.7, 7.8
Node.js 12.4.0 12.8.1 12.5, 12.6, 12.7, 12.8, 12.8.1
  • Added Windows on Arm (64 bit) release. #18591, #20112
  • Added ipcRenderer.invoke() and ipcMain.handle() for asynchronous request/response-style IPC. These are strongly recommended over the remote module. See this "Electron’s ‘remote’ module considered harmful" blog post for more information. #18449
  • Added nativeTheme API to read and respond to changes in the OS's theme and color scheme. #19758, #20486
  • Switched to a new TypeScript Definitions generator, which generates more precise definitions. If your TypeScript build fails, this is the likely cause. #18103

Breaking Changes

More information about these and future changes can be found on project's Planned Breaking Changes page.

  • Removed deprecated APIs:
    • Callback-based versions of functions that now use Promises. #17907
... (truncated)
Commits
  • cac0a4f Bump v7.0.1
  • e6807b3 ci: Revert CircleCI changes (#20916)
  • f6f73a5 Revert "Bump v7.0.1"
  • 7bad919 Bump v7.0.1
  • 667db6f chore: bump chromium in DEPS to 78.0.3904.92 (#20913)
  • 022ee37 build: allow CircleCI timeout and retry to be set via env variables (7-0-x) (...
  • 5c0e8c5 Revert "Bump v7.0.1"
  • 961436f Bump v7.0.1
  • e2c7e4b fix: use Unicode version of ShellExecute() in OpenExternalOnWorkerThread() (#...
  • d12b0ee Revert "Bump v7.0.1"
  • Additional commits viewable in compare view

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
  • @dependabot use these labels will set the current labels as the default for future PRs for this repo and language
  • @dependabot use these reviewers will set the current reviewers as the default for future PRs for this repo and language
  • @dependabot use these assignees will set the current assignees as the default for future PRs for this repo and language
  • @dependabot use this milestone will set the current milestone as the default for future PRs for this repo and language
  • @dependabot badge me will comment on this PR with code to add a "Dependabot enabled" badge to your readme

Additionally, you can set the following in your Dependabot dashboard:

  • Update frequency (including time of day and day of week)
  • Pull request limits (per update run and/or open at any time)
  • Automerge options (never/patch/minor, and dev/runtime dependencies)
  • Out-of-range updates (receive only lockfile updates, if desired)
  • Security updates (receive only security updates, if desired)

Bumps [electron](https://github.com/electron/electron) from 5.0.4 to 7.0.1.
- [Release notes](https://github.com/electron/electron/releases)
- [Commits](electron/electron@v5.0.4...v7.0.1)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>
@dependabot-preview dependabot-preview Bot added the dependencies Pull requests that update a dependency file label Nov 4, 2019
@dependabot-preview
Copy link
Copy Markdown
Contributor Author

Superseded by #341.

@dependabot-preview dependabot-preview Bot deleted the dependabot/npm_and_yarn/electron-7.0.1 branch November 6, 2019 01:23
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file

Projects

None yet

Development

Successfully merging this pull request may close these issues.

0 participants